Shingleback Skink
The Shingleback Skink (Tiliqua rugosa) is one of the commonly seen large lizard species in western NSW and Queensland. They are commonly encountered in warm weather slowly crossing roads. They are known by many names including bog-eye, pinecone lizard and bobtail
